Using StrongBad's hitstun calculator and the Zelda frame data thread, I've attempted to create a chart for all the combos Zelda can do.

Here is the chart.

It's a very basic chart. It doesn't account for the victim's position when they get out of hitstun, so e.g. you can't actually hit FW (reappearance hitbox)>Usmash>Usmash>Nair>LK, because FW knocks the victim too far away to hit Usmash. Likewise, it doesn't account for DI, or smash DI. Neither does it account for landing lag on the aerial moves. But, assuming I've done the math right, the chart shows when there are enough frames of hitstun to connect with a given move to connect with a given followup.

Perhaps more importantly, it says for certain what combinations are not true combos, because there isn't enough hit advantage for the second move to connect. E.g. dash attack's late hit (that sends the opponent up) is a really terrible combo starter that doesn't combo into anything from 0-30.
